What to Know

Critics Consensus

An intriguing blend of horror and noir, Archive 81 offers addictive supernatural thrills that are haunting in the best way.

Episodes

Episode 1 Aired Jan 14, 2022 Mystery Signals Haunted by a family tragedy, Dan begins to restore videotapes for a cryptic film; he's startled to learn of his connection to their missing creator. Details Episode 2 Aired Jan 14, 2022 Wellspring Messages from the dead arrive while Dan follows Melody on her investigation into the Visser. Details Episode 3 Aired Jan 14, 2022 Terror in the Aisles The past loops back around as Melody returns to Steven with Jess; Mark checks out a find; Dan tries to map his situation, but he may be losing his way. Details Episode 4 Aired Jan 14, 2022 Spirit Receivers In the woods, Dan encounters the unexpected; in the tapes, Melody learns about the cult and makes contact during a shocking séance. Details Episode 5 Aired Jan 14, 2022 Through the Looking Glass The past blurs into the present when Melody visits a forbidden floor in search of an inspired Anabelle; music leads to lost souls and revelations. Details Episode 6 Aired Jan 14, 2022 The Circle Panic grows when Dan learns about his predecessor and Melody tries to track the source of the Visser's dangers. Details Episode 7 Aired Jan 14, 2022 The Ferryman The veil drops from a cursed film's origins; at the Vos Mansion in 1924, Iris recruits Rose for a blood ritual; Dan knows he must find Anabelle. Details Episode 8 Aired Jan 14, 2022 What Lies Beneath The Otherworld beckons; Melody circles back to the Visser, where a new devices captures a sacrifice; much depends on Dan's journey into the unknown.
